U-Teach: Journal of Young Physics Education Teacher is a scientific journal published with the aim of facilitating academics and researchers to publish their research findings in the fields of Physics Education Innovation, Physics Learning Media and Scientific Research in the field of physics. U-Teach: Journal of Young Physics Teacher Education is a journal published by the STKIP Physics Education Study Program Nurul Huda. U-Teach will start appearing in June 2020 ie Vol. 1 No. 1 of 2020, with and regularly published twice per year in June and December.
Focus articles that can be published on U-Teach Here are the details:
1. Physics Learning Innovation: models, strategies, approaches, development of teaching materials and media in learning physics.
2. Scientific research: physics experiments and physics development research.
